Because of Mythos, or something?
yes. most people have no idea about weapons and armor, so popular stuff = the best stuff.

as for games: mount and blade/warband. axes and maces tend to be better because armor does not absorb as much piercing/blunt damage then it does slashing, and mounted knights with lances fuck everything up like they did in real life.

edit: i think with broadsword he means those mid-medieval arming swords that have a broad base but a sharp point.
